What is the interpretation of the events in Salman's "false hadith" regarding the signs of the Hour having already occurred, and were these signs, especially the social ones, mentioned in other authentic hadiths?
The hadith known as "Salman's hadith concerning the Prophet's sermon during his Hajj while he was holding the Kaaba's door ring" is a fabricated and forged hadith. Its fabricator combined two elements in its composition: First, he included some signs that had appeared during the time the hadith was fabricated (the second century Hijri and thereafter), such as the lengthening of pulpits, infatuation with young boys, and swearing by divorce. Second, he incorporated texts from other authentic hadiths about the signs of the Hour, such as the spread of trade, the proximity of markets, believing the liar and disbelieving the truthful, competing in building tall structures, a slave woman giving birth to her mistress, and the adornment of mosques.
